1A HILLFIELD ROAD is a very large extended semi-detached house of 204m², built sometime between 1950 and 1966. It was last sold for £812,111 in October 2021, which was around 1% below the average October 2021 detached price in the Reigate and Banstead local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2021,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

1A HILLFIELD ROAD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Reigate and Banstead local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 1A HILLFIELD ROAD sales from February 1998 and October 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the February 1998 sale was for 19%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 19% below the HPI over time, until the October 2021 sale, where it rises to 1%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 1% below the HPI.

How Large is 1A HILLFIELD ROAD?

1A HILLFIELD ROAD is 204m², which includes three extensions, according to the EPC inspection conducted in February 2021. This puts it in the largest 20% of detached houses in Redhill, based on EPC data. The below chart shows the distribution of detached houses by size in Redhill, and where 1A HILLFIELD ROAD lies on this distribution: 87% of detached houses are smaller than 1A HILLFIELD ROAD, and 13% of houses are larger. Note that EPC data is not available for all properties in Redhill.

1A HILLFIELD ROAD: Plot and Title Map

1A HILLFIELD ROAD sits on a plot of roughly 0.159 of an acre, or 645m². The below map shows the location of 1A HILLFIELD ROAD,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 1A HILLFIELD ROAD).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
